Believe, build, and belong at Burton.
At Burton Middle School, we believe in establishing strong partnership between scholars, caregivers, and the community. We recognize that caregivers are the primary educators of their child, and we work collaboratively with each family to help our scholars take ownership of their education and develop a positive outlook of their future. We believe in creating an environment of high expectations, respect, open communication, diversity of ideas, and trust.
Additionally, Burton Middle School is proud to serve as a Cultural Center for middle school scholars in southwest Grand Rapids. Our staff is trained to support English Learners, and our language lab classes are designed to help develop scholars’ English and Spanish skills. We know that our scholars learn best when their cultures are valued. Therefore, we welcome and celebrate scholars’ cultural diversity.
We have incorporated distance learning for years and are poised to be a leader in the district as a blended model of new technologies and old practices, giving our students the best of both worlds. Our 1-to-1 student technology device approach ensures that every student has the opportunity to learn inside and outside the classroom.
